4 Subject: [PATCH] Fix locking of GLsync objects.
6 GLsync objects had a race condition when used from multiple threads
7 (which is the main point of the extension, really); it could be
8 validated as a sync object at the beginning of the function, and then
9 deleted by another thread before use, causing crashes. Fix this by
10 changing all casts from GLsync to struct gl_sync_object to a new
11 function _mesa_get_sync() that validates and increases the refcount.
13 In a similar vein, validation itself uses _mesa_set_search(), which
14 requires synchronization -- it was called without a mutex held, causing
15 spurious error returns and other issues. Since _mesa_get_sync() now
16 takes the shared context mutex, this problem is also resolved.
